Ji Feng is an ordinary student in Class 13. He has average grades, sits by the window, and is not gregarious. He only filled his notebooks with lines and color blocks, and his temper was like a faucet that was not tightened, exploding at the slightest moment.
No one knows that there is a name named Yu Jianshen hidden in his painting book.
This name belongs to the academic god who always ranks first in his grade. A year ago, he was like a star that suddenly broke into orbit and briefly illuminated the world of Monsoon. Then due to family reasons, he transferred schools and left without warning.
Since then, every monsoon night has become infinitely longer.
He painted and tore up the painting, and the moon outside the window was tired of seeing his lost face. He thought that the star belonging to Yu Jianshen would never come back again.
Until the day of the opening ceremony, that familiar figure appeared on the podium again.
Yu Jianshen spoke as a representative of the new students, but his eyes accurately passed through the crowd and landed on Ji Feng in the corner. His eyes were still calm, but at the moment they touched the monsoon, there was an imperceptible warmth.
After the meeting, Ji Feng clutched his painting book like a frightened cat, wanting to escape quickly.
But his wrist was gently grasped from behind.
"Why are you running?" Yu Jianshen's voice was clear and clear, with a subtle smile, "Ji Feng, I haven't seen you for a year, you don't want to see me so much?"
Ji Feng turned around suddenly and looked into his deep eyes.
"Why are you back?"
Yu Jianshen came closer and said in a voice that only the two of them could hear: "Because someone said, 'You are not an insignificant stardust, but the entire starry sky sleeping.' I have to come back and guard this starry sky myself."
